Umrah is a non-mandatory pilgrimage to Mecca that can be performed at any time of the year. It involves specific rituals and is considered a means of spiritual purification.

No, Umrah is not obligatory like Hajj, but it is highly recommended and holds significant spiritual merit.

Men should wear the Ihram, which consists of two white, unstitched cloths. Women should wear modest clothing that covers their arms and legs.

While Umrah can be performed anytime, many prefer the winter months for cooler weather and fewer crowds.
